A good preparation

In terms of exam preparation, nothing beats practicing. A key component to this was taking a practice exam. I have read several reviews that said that the practice exam is too dificult in comparison to the actual exam, but really that is a false assessment. THough the problems are in fact more time consuming and dificult, it is representative, and if you can take and pass the practice exam, you will breeze through the real thing. I highly recommend this product to anyone preparing for the PE.

Use it wisely

I purchased this exam book along with Lindeburg's practice problems Practice Problems for the Mechanical Engineering PE Exam: A Companion to the Mechanical Engineering Reference Manual, 12th Editionand reference manualMechanical Engineering Reference Manual for the PE Exam (11th Edition). The exam is very similar to the actual NCEES exam in format and content. It is actually more difficult than the NCEES exam but don't let that fact cause you to become complacent. The PE exam is tough and alot of people fail it. With that said, the way I used this practice exam was to treat it like it was exam day. About 2 weeks before the exam I went to the library with my calculator, stop watch, and reference materials. I opened the book and exactly four hours later closed it. I spent the next four hours examining my results and where I made mistakes. The next day I did the same thing with the afternoon portion of the test. I did not crack a peak at the exam beforehand so I had no idea what the problems were going to be. Of course I had spent the previous two months reviewing the reference book and doing the practice problems. This gave me the necessary skills to use my time wisely during the actual exam. You only have four hours for 40 problems, that's 6 minutes per problem. If you've wasted 4 minutes on a particular question and are not near the solution, it's best to move on and if you have time, come back to it. It's not only what you know but you have to have the ability to look things up quickly and use your time wisely. I also used the same study method with the example exam available from NCEES (which is an absolute necessity). I passed the April 09 exam so my method was effective for me. Much harder than actual test

This is worth buying, and taking about 1 month before the test. This test was much harder than the actual test- I could only get about half of the problems complete, and I had time to spare for the real exam. But it gives you good practice in frantically looking up the required information. I would like it to be easier like the real test, because I was panicing for about a week after taking this practice exam.
